I enjoy them, mainly b/c they had Brian McBride and now have Clint Dempsey. They are known for carrying American born players, hence the nickname. But they will not be near the top of the table anytime soon if you want a winning team, lol.
Marcus Hahnemann - 1999-2001
Eddie Lewis - 2000-2002
Carlos Bocanegra - 2004-2008
Brian McBride - 2004-2008
Kasey Keller - 2007-2008
Clint Dempsey - 2007- present
Eddie Johnson - joined Fulham in 2008 (now on loan to Cardiff City)
